Charles, the son of Michael Gilbert of New Chappel Lane and master of the Free School, was born on 11 Apr 1684 and baptised at Leeds in Yorkshire on 1 May 1684.[1]
He may be the Charles Gilbert buried at Leeds on 3 Jan 1741.[2]
